900 MHz频段干扰研究和解决方案

摘要 900 MHz频段的干扰一直是4G网络部署中的难题,也是4G重耕到5G需要考虑的关键因素。通过分析网管数据和外场测试数据,总结了典型的外部干扰类型,并研究底噪抬升对吞吐率指标、接入指标、丢包率指标的影响。干扰对上行吞吐率影响较大,对下行吞吐率、接入类和掉线率指标影响较小,不同的干扰波形对指标的影响程度不同。基于分析结果,提出900 MHz干扰的解决方案,包括窄带尖峰干扰和宽带干扰解决方案,来降低干扰对用户和网络的影响。 900 MHz band interference has always been a difficult problem in 4 G network deployment,and it is still a key factor in the evolution from 4 G to 5 G.Through the analysis of network management data and field test data,the typical external interference types are summarized,and the impact of noise increase on throughput rate indicators,access indicators,and packet loss rate indicators is studied.Interference has a greater impact on the uplink throughput rate,and has less impact on the downlink throughput rate,access and drop rate indicators.Different interference waveforms have different impact on the indicators.Based on the analysis results,solutions for 900 MHz interference are proposed,including solutions for narrowband interference and broadband interference,to reduce the impact of interference on users and the network.
